Job summary

A fantastic opportunity has arisen for a part-time, experienced practice nurse to join Chelmer Medical Partnership in Chelmsford. The position is offered for 20 hours per week, Monday and Thursday 8.00am to 6.30pm with a 30-minute unpaid break. Candidates will be required to work across the partnership's three sites. These are; Humber Road Surgery, Melbourne House Surgery and Tennyson House Surgery.

You will work closely with a team of supportive and collaborative clinicians to ensure the greatest level of care is delivered to all patients.

Main duties of the job

  • Delivering exceptional levels of care to all patients.
  • Working autonomously and as part of a team.
  • Providing flu vaccinations.
  • Providing cervical cytology.
  • Carrying out contraceptive reviews.
  • Providing immunisations.
  • Delivering wound care.

Disclosure and Barring Service Check

This post is subject to the Rehabilitation of Offenders Act (Exceptions Order) 1975 and as such it will be necessary for a submission for Disclosure to be made to the Disclosure and Barring Service (formerly known as CRB) to check for any previous criminal convictions.
